
A Nigerian X (formerly Twitter) user, @AshE-Nuel, has shared a heartbreaking story about how his relationship with a female member of the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) came to an abrupt end.
According to him, he had already completed his NYSC while his girlfriend still had about four months left to serve. He revealed that he had serious intentions of proposing to her immediately after her service year.
However, things took a painful turn when a close friend contacted him after spotting his girlfriend at a club. The friend reportedly sent a photo showing her seated in the VIP section, which immediately raised concerns.
Shocked, he confronted her and requested a video call, but she allegedly blamed her inability to connect on a low phone battery. Moments later, his friend sent him a video clip showing another man getting physically intimate with her at the club.
The discovery left him devastated.
Recounting how he handled the situation, he wrote:
“She saw it an hour later and started calling my phone. I picked up and said, ‘From Sokoto to Ibadan to a club?’ I switched off my phone. I couldn’t sleep, all the foolish proposals I wanted to make, I quickly scrapped. The next day, I was shaken, but I had to let her go. I told her, ‘You’re not worth my sweat.’”
Despite her repeated pleas and attempts to reach him, he chose to end the relationship.
The viral post has since sparked mixed reactions online, with many debating trust, loyalty, and the challenges of long-distance relationships during the NYSC year.
